    Update Ionic Capacitor apps without App/Play Store review (Code-push / hot-code updates).

    You have 3 ways possible :

    • Use capgo.app a full featured auto-update system in 5 min Setup, to manage version, update, revert and see stats.
    • Use your own server update with auto-update system
    • Use manual methods to zip, upload, download, from JS to do it when you want.

    iOS

    Privacy manifest

    Add the NSPrivacyAccessedAPICategoryUserDefaults dictionary key to your Privacy Manifest (usually ios/App/PrivacyInfo.xcprivacy):

    <?xml version="1.0" encoding="UTF-8"?>
    <!DOCTYPE plist PUBLIC "-//Apple//DTD PLIST 1.0//EN" "http://www.apple.com/DTDs/PropertyList-1.0.dtd">
    <plist version="1.0">
      <dict>
        <key>NSPrivacyAccessedAPITypes</key>
        <array>
          <!-- Add this dict entry to the array if the file already exists. -->
          <dict>
            <key>NSPrivacyAccessedAPIType</key>
            <string>NSPrivacyAccessedAPICategoryUserDefaults</string>
            <key>NSPrivacyAccessedAPITypeReasons</key>
            <array>
              <string>CA92.1</string>
            </array>
          </dict>
        </array>
      </dict>
    </plist>

    We recommend to declare CA92.1 as the reason for accessing the UserDefaults API.

    Manual setup

    Download update distribution zipfiles from a custom URL. Manually control the entire update process.

    • Edit your capacitor.config.json like below, set autoUpdate to false.
    // capacitor.config.json
    {
        "appId": "**.***.**",
        "appName": "Name",
        "plugins": {
            "CapacitorUpdater": {
                "autoUpdate": false,
            }
        }
    }
    • Add to your main code
      import { CapacitorUpdater } from '@capgo/capacitor-updater'
      CapacitorUpdater.notifyAppReady()

    This informs Capacitor Updater that the current update bundle has loaded succesfully. Failing to call this method will cause your application to be rolled back to the previously successful version (or built-in bundle).

    • Add this to your application.
      const version = await CapacitorUpdater.download({
        url: 'https://github.com/Cap-go/demo-app/releases/download/0.0.4/dist.zip',
      })
      await CapacitorUpdater.set(version); // sets the new version, and reloads the app
    • Failed updates will automatically roll back to the last successful version.
    • Example: Using App-state to control updates, with SplashScreen: You might also consider performing auto-update when application state changes, and using the Splash Screen to improve user experience.
      import { CapacitorUpdater, VersionInfo } from '@capgo/capacitor-updater'
      import { SplashScreen } from '@capacitor/splash-screen'
      import { App } from '@capacitor/app'
    
      let version: VersionInfo;
      App.addListener('appStateChange', async (state) => {
          if (state.isActive) {
            // Ensure download occurs while the app is active, or download may fail
            version = await CapacitorUpdater.download({
              url: 'https://github.com/Cap-go/demo-app/releases/download/0.0.4/dist.zip',
            })
          }
    
          if (!state.isActive && version) {
            // Activate the update when the application is sent to background
            SplashScreen.show()
            try {
              await CapacitorUpdater.set(version);
              // At this point, the new version should be active, and will need to hide the splash screen
            } catch () {
              SplashScreen.hide() // Hide the splash screen again if something went wrong
            }
          }
      })

    Store Guideline Compliance

    Android Google Play and iOS App Store have corresponding guidelines that have rules you should be aware of before integrating the Capacitor-updater solution within your application.

    Google play

    Third paragraph of Device and Network Abuse topic describe that updating source code by any method besides Google Play's update mechanism is restricted. But this restriction does not apply to updating JavaScript bundles.

    This restriction does not apply to code that runs in a virtual machine and has limited access to Android APIs (such as JavaScript in a web view or browser).

    That fully allow Capacitor-updater as it updates just JS bundles and can't update native code part.

    App Store

    Paragraph 3.3.2, since back in 2015's Apple Developer Program License Agreement fully allowed performing over-the-air updates of JavaScript and assets.

    And in its latest version (20170605) downloadable here this ruling is even broader:

    Interpreted code may be downloaded to an Application, but only so long as such code:

    • (a) does not change the primary purpose of the Application by providing features or functionality that are inconsistent with the intended and advertised purpose of the Application as submitted to the App Store
    • (b) does not create a store or storefront for other code or applications
    • (c) does not bypass signing, sandbox, or other security features of the OS.

    Capacitor-updater allows you to respect these rules in full compliance, so long as the update you push does not significantly deviate your product from its original App Store approved intent.

    To further remain in compliance with Apple's guidelines, we suggest that App Store-distributed apps don't enable the Force update scenario, since in the App Store Review Guidelines it is written that:

    Apps must not force users to rate the app, review the app, download other apps, or other similar actions to access functionality, content, or use of the app.

    This is not a problem for the default behavior of background update, since it won't force the user to apply the new version until the next app close, but at least you should be aware of that ruling if you decide to show it.

    Packaging dist.zip update bundles

    Capacitor Updater works by unzipping a compiled app bundle to the native device filesystem. Whatever you choose to name the file you upload/download from your release/update server URL (via either manual or automatic updating), this .zip bundle must meet the following requirements:

    • The zip file should contain the full contents of your production Capacitor build output folder, usually {project directory}/dist/ or {project directory}/www/. This is where index.html will be located, and it should also contain all bundled JavaScript, CSS, and web resources necessary for your app to run.
    • Do not password encrypt the bundle zip file, or it will fail to unpack.
    • Make sure the bundle does not contain any extra hidden files or folders, or it may fail to unpack.

    Updater Plugin Config

    CapacitorUpdater can be configured with these options:

    Prop Type Description Default Since
    appReadyTimeout number Configure the number of milliseconds the native plugin should wait before considering an update 'failed'. Only available for Android and iOS. 10000 // (10 seconds)
    responseTimeout number Configure the number of milliseconds the native plugin should wait before considering API timeout. Only available for Android and iOS. 20 // (20 second)
    autoDeleteFailed boolean Configure whether the plugin should use automatically delete failed bundles. Only available for Android and iOS. true
    autoDeletePrevious boolean Configure whether the plugin should use automatically delete previous bundles after a successful update. Only available for Android and iOS. true
    autoUpdate boolean Configure whether the plugin should use Auto Update via an update server. Only available for Android and iOS. true
    resetWhenUpdate boolean Automatically delete previous downloaded bundles when a newer native app bundle is installed to the device. Only available for Android and iOS. true
    updateUrl string Configure the URL / endpoint to which update checks are sent. Only available for Android and iOS. https://plugin.capgo.app/updates
    channelUrl string Configure the URL / endpoint for channel operations. Only available for Android and iOS. https://plugin.capgo.app/channel_self
    statsUrl string Configure the URL / endpoint to which update statistics are sent. Only available for Android and iOS. Set to "" to disable stats reporting. https://plugin.capgo.app/stats
    publicKey string Configure the public key for end to end live update encryption Version 2 Only available for Android and iOS. undefined 6.2.0
    version string Configure the current version of the app. This will be used for the first update request. If not set, the plugin will get the version from the native code. Only available for Android and iOS. undefined 4.17.48
    directUpdate boolean Make the plugin direct install the update when the app what just updated/installed. Only for autoUpdate mode. Only available for Android and iOS. undefined 5.1.0
    periodCheckDelay number Configure the delay period for period update check. the unit is in seconds. Only available for Android and iOS. Cannot be less than 600 seconds (10 minutes). 600 // (10 minutes)
    localS3 boolean Configure the CLI to use a local server for testing or self-hosted update server. undefined 4.17.48
    localHost string Configure the CLI to use a local server for testing or self-hosted update server. undefined 4.17.48
    localWebHost string Configure the CLI to use a local server for testing or self-hosted update server. undefined 4.17.48
    localSupa string Configure the CLI to use a local server for testing or self-hosted update server. undefined 4.17.48
    localSupaAnon string Configure the CLI to use a local server for testing. undefined 4.17.48
    localApi string Configure the CLI to use a local api for testing. undefined 6.3.3
    localApiFiles string Configure the CLI to use a local file api for testing. undefined 6.3.3
    allowModifyUrl boolean Allow the plugin to modify the updateUrl, statsUrl and channelUrl dynamically from the JavaScript side. false 5.4.0
    defaultChannel string Set the default channel for the app in the config. undefined 5.5.0
    appId string Configure the app id for the app in the config. undefined 6.0.0
    keepUrlPathAfterReload boolean Configure the plugin to keep the URL path after a reload. WARNING: When a reload is triggered, 'window.history' will be cleared. false 6.8.0

    setMultiDelay(...)

    setMultiDelay(options: MultiDelayConditions) => Promise<void>

    Sets a {@link DelayCondition} array containing conditions that the Plugin will use to delay the update. After all conditions are met, the update process will run start again as usual, so update will be installed after a backgrounding or killing the app. For the date kind, the value should be an iso8601 date string. For the background kind, the value should be a number in milliseconds. For the nativeVersion kind, the value should be the version number. For the kill kind, the value is not used. The function has unconsistent behavior the option kill do trigger the update after the first kill and not after the next background like other options. This will be fixed in a future major release.

    Param Type Description
    options MultiDelayConditions Containing the {@link MultiDelayConditions} array of conditions to set

    Since: 4.3.0

    setChannel(...)

    setChannel(options: SetChannelOptions) => Promise<ChannelRes>

    Sets the channel for this device. The channel has to allow for self assignment for this to work. Do not use this method to set the channel at boot when autoUpdate is enabled in the {@link PluginsConfig}. This method is to set the channel after the app is ready. This methods send to Capgo backend a request to link the device ID to the channel. Capgo can accept or refuse depending of the setting of your channel.

    Param Type Description
    options SetChannelOptions Is the {@link SetChannelOptions} channel to set

    Returns: Promise<ChannelRes>

    Since: 4.7.0
